<kbd id="afajh"><form id="afajh"></form></kbd>
<strong id="afajh"><dl id="afajh"></dl></strong>
    <del id="afajh"><form id="afajh"></form></del>
        1. <th id="afajh"><progress id="afajh"></progress></th>
          <b id="afajh"><abbr id="afajh"></abbr></b>
          <th id="afajh"><progress id="afajh"></progress></th>

          知乎熱問:一個程序員的水平能差到什么程度?

          共 2279字,需瀏覽 5分鐘

           ·

          2022-06-27 22:09

          想起了一件十多年前的往事,有一次幫客戶的Java項目組升級框架。

          入場之后屢次聽到項目組的運維小哥抱怨war包過大,導致每次發(fā)布要等很久很久,用過WebSphere的童鞋可能知道我在說什么。

          那么,這war有多大呢?

          接近2G?。。。???

          富有求知欲的我于是下決心去研究下這鴿子,,不對,這war包為什么這么大?

          草草一挖,果然就在里面發(fā)現(xiàn)了寶貝。

          原來war包里還藏著兩個程序安裝包。

          一個是JDK1.4;

          另一個是PES2006,,,,實....實況足球?!

          圖片

          根據(jù)SVN的提交記錄,肇事的大哥很快就被找到了。

          據(jù)說是在一個月黑風高的晚上,幾個還在加班的碼畜臨時起意,決定一起找點樂子解解乏。這位帶頭大哥為了方便把自己的游戲分享給小伙伴,就想到了把它先提交到SVN上這樣一個天才的主意。。。。當然,按照他原本的計劃,這個文件應(yīng)該隨后被刪除的。。??墒牵峭硭麄兺娴膶嵲谔M興了。。。。

          沒人會料到這個文件竟會悄無聲息的溜進war包,一路潛伏到生產(chǎn)環(huán)境,然后反反復復的摩擦了可憐的WebSphere和運維小哥近一年。

          了解到真相之后,運維小哥表情差不多是這樣的↓

          圖片

          老板覺得公司里都是男的,缺少一點陰柔之氣,想平衡一下,正巧當時互金公司倒了一大批,大批簡歷投到公司,老板以為自己也是技術(shù)出身,就招了一個三年工作經(jīng)驗的女程序員,互金出來的,要價倒是不低。我休假去了,沒面她,等我回來要安排工作了,這才發(fā)現(xiàn)問題了。

          給她安排了一個新項目,是會展方面的,跟她簡單說了一下工作安排:先搭個spring maven項目,然后跟產(chǎn)品談下需求,考慮一下數(shù)據(jù)模型,過兩天跟我碰再確定具體模型。她沒說什么,等到第二天快下班了,產(chǎn)品來問我了,她怎么還沒動工?我說我安排了啊,這就找過去問她,她說框架還等著技術(shù)總監(jiān)(也就是我)搭了,她不是架構(gòu)師,不會。

          當時我就懵了,還有這種操作,你就是上spring網(wǎng)站都能搭一個啊。又問她需求談了沒有?數(shù)據(jù)模型有沒有想出個大概?她又說,需求是BA談的,她不會。我這就急了,那你會什么呀?她說她原來公司都是框架環(huán)境都是配好的,她只管寫代碼。我當時心里就涼了半截,這項目估計最后要我來收拾殘局了。這就去找老板換人,老板說你就帶帶她吧,反正這項目也不急,就當給公司添一點亮色吧!

          沒辦法,只能硬著頭皮帶她了,期間各種eclipse環(huán)境之類的就不談了,比如svn配置忽略文件類型,lombok插件等等,總之環(huán)境不會配。終于幫她全部配完環(huán)境,詳設(shè)也寫好跟她講解了一遍,總算開工了,若干天后提交代碼了,我做了一下code review,這心里又涼了半截:方法,類名,變量等等一概中文拼音;業(yè)務(wù)邏輯明明可以復用的不寫公用方法,跟別提用自定義注解了;駝峰命名法是什么不知道;

          Mysql有的表字段名全大寫,有的全小寫,有的又跟我來個駝峰。我又跑去找老板要換人,老板打個哈哈,哎呀,又不是人人都有這個你這個水平,再帶帶說不定就出來了。沒轍,給我戴頂高帽子,只好回去跟她苦口婆心地說了半天代碼規(guī)范,其實就是阿里那一套,裝個插件就能檢查,又跟她著重講了一下命名規(guī)范,要用英文命名,否則注釋少的話很難看懂程序,她直點頭,說這就改,我也就信了。

          等到代碼再次提交,我一看,一口鮮血差點沒吐在屏幕上,展品的長寬高單位是米,結(jié)果好家伙一看,長度long_rice,高度high_rice,當時看的時候?qū)嵲跊]明白這腦回路到底是個什么套路,強壓怒火跑去問她這是什么意思,她振振有詞地說:你講的呀,命名的時候最好要體現(xiàn)度量單位。

          我實在忍不住了,吼起來了:那rice是什么單位,是什么單位?她也不示弱,把詞霸的屏幕取詞一開,移到米字那里,說:你自己看,米不就是rice嗎!我頓時無語,只能又跑去找老板,老板也無語,只能自我解嘲地說:她不是過了四級了嗎,我還查來著了。

          這件事情最后的結(jié)局就是我在面人的時候,都要當面問幾個英語單詞,實在是怕了。

          rice這個我是實在沒看明白,記得還有一處我是看明白了,她把發(fā)消息的發(fā)命名為hair,我愣了一下也就知道。

          知乎眾大概還都是層次比較高的,認為這么簡單的英語都不會是不太可能的,但實際上這兩天我又在面試,我看一位同學的筆試題寫的代碼里有scanner,然后面試的時候就問了他一句:scan是什么意思?想了半天,沒說出來。

          我們創(chuàng)建了一個高質(zhì)量的技術(shù)交流群,與優(yōu)秀的人在一起,自己也會優(yōu)秀起來,趕緊點擊加群,享受一起成長的快樂。另外,如果你最近想跳槽的話,年前我花了2周時間收集了一波大廠面經(jīng),節(jié)后準備跳槽的可以點擊這里領(lǐng)取!

          推薦閱讀

          ··································

          你好,我是程序猿DD,10年開發(fā)老司機、阿里云MVP、騰訊云TVP、出過書創(chuàng)過業(yè)、國企4年互聯(lián)網(wǎng)6年從普通開發(fā)到架構(gòu)師、再到合伙人。一路過來,給我最深的感受就是一定要不斷學習并關(guān)注前沿。只要你能堅持下來,多思考、少抱怨、勤動手,就很容易實現(xiàn)彎道超車!所以,不要問我現(xiàn)在干什么是否來得及。如果你看好一個事情,一定是堅持了才能看到希望,而不是看到希望才去堅持。相信我,只要堅持下來,你一定比現(xiàn)在更好!如果你還沒什么方向,可以先關(guān)注我,這里會經(jīng)常分享一些前沿資訊,幫你積累彎道超車的資本。

          點擊領(lǐng)取2022最新10000T學習資料
          瀏覽 36
          點贊
          評論
          收藏
          分享

          手機掃一掃分享

          分享
          舉報
          評論
          圖片
          表情
          推薦
          點贊
          評論
          收藏
          分享

          手機掃一掃分享

          分享
          舉報
          <kbd id="afajh"><form id="afajh"></form></kbd>
          <strong id="afajh"><dl id="afajh"></dl></strong>
            <del id="afajh"><form id="afajh"></form></del>
                1. <th id="afajh"><progress id="afajh"></progress></th>
                  <b id="afajh"><abbr id="afajh"></abbr></b>
                  <th id="afajh"><progress id="afajh"></progress></th>
                  欧美操逼视频免费观看 | 亚洲精品福利导航 | 久久国产乱子伦精品 | 色色影音先锋 | 久操网免费视频在线观看 |